Output 38902d506963d819d0918fe627c02ab8c756cdc0c20154d2cacbed2d4b8e039b:1

value
868280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d505421abbb8b19269c2d04dca4b8bf0bda3833 OP_EQUAL
address
3D7ccrVsMJz73ULEFEHSyfhxakBfdUh1gn
transaction
38902d506963d819d0918fe627c02ab8c756cdc0c20154d2cacbed2d4b8e039b
spent
true